PhD position
The Faculty of Medicine, Department of Clinical Science, is offering a full-time PhD-position for a duration of four (4) years. The position includes 25% mandatory duties such as teaching, exam work, or supervision, depending on departmental needs.
The position is part of the project “Temporary inconvenience or early warning signs? A new take on maternal symptoms in early pregnancy and their consequences”, funded by the University of Bergen.
About the project/work tasks:
Pregnancy is a unique time of life where mother and child live in symbiosis. This relationship however induces multiple symptoms for mothers including nausea, vomiting, bleeding, pain, fatigue and many more. Do you want to discover why women become sick and what it means for the future health of mother and child?
The candidate will be given the opportunity to work on the Norwegian Mother, Father and Child Cohort Study, a unique study with detailed information on approximately hundred thousand pregnancies (fhi.no/en/ch/studies/moba ). The candidate will study symptoms in early pregnancy using genetic epidemiology. The project will be performed at the Center for Diabetes Research (uib.no/en/diabetes ) located at the Children and Youth Hospital in Bergen, Norway. The candidate will be provided guidance and training, will receive help for the development of their career, and will be given the opportunity to conduct research exchanges abroad.
Other work tasks:
- Curate and organize symptoms reported by women during pregnancy
- Establish pregnancy profiles based on the prevalence and timing of symptoms
- Study the genetic underpinnings of the symptoms using SNP array data

About the PhD position (applies to university PhD positions):
Applicants whose educational qualifications are from countries other than Norway must provide a certified translation of the diploma and transcript of grades to English or a Scandinavian language, if the original documents are not in any of these languages. It is also required that the applicant submit a review from the Norwegian Directorate for Higher Education and Skills (HK-dir) to verify whether the education in question (bachelor and master's degree) is of a scope and level that corresponds to the level of a Norwegian master’s degree. Please see https://hkdir.no/en/ for more information about HK-dir’s general recognition. The review process by HK-dir may take some time. Therefore, please submit your application to HK-dir as soon as you decide to apply for the position. If you do not receive a response within the application deadline, you must include documentation from HK-dir confirming receipt of your application. Please note that the automatic recognition offered by HK-dir insufficient and will not be accepted as basis for admission to the PhD programme. Applicants with education from a Nordic country or those with a medical degree from the EEA area and a license to practice medicine in Norway are exempt from the requirement for HK-dir assessment.
